SQLServer2000数据模型:从现实到计算机世界的转换

需积分: 43 12 下载量 188 浏览量 更新于2024-08-23 收藏 1.14MB PPT 举报
"教学院系数据模型主要探讨了如何构建数据模型和概念模型,特别是在教育领域中的应用。这个模型包括院系、教研室、学生和教师四个主要实体,以及它们之间的关联。在数据模型中,列举了具体的实例,如计算机系(D10)下有硬件和软件两个教研室,以及相关的学生和教师信息。数据模型的构建通常会经历现实世界、信息世界和计算机世界三个阶段,其中,概念模型是描述事物及事物间静态联系的,常用E-R图表示;过程模型关注处理方法和信息加工过程,常用数据流图和数据字典表示;状态模型则关注事物的动态变化,通常用状态图来表达。" 在教育领域的数据模型中,"院系"实体可能包含"院系编号"、"院系名称"和"办公地点"等属性,例如"计算机系"(D10),办公地点在"9号楼"。"教研室"实体则有"教研室编号"和"教研室名称",比如"硬件教研室"(C01)和"软件教研室"(C02)。"学生"实体可能包括"学号"、"姓名"、"年龄"和"专业方向",例如"王平"(00001),20岁,专业方向未明确。"教师"实体则有"职工号"、"姓名"和"专业方向",例如"王海"(92001),专业方向是"电器"。 在信息的现实世界中,"实体"是客观存在的事物或概念,比如"学生"、"教师"。实体的特征,即"属性",用来描述实体的特性,如学生的"姓名"、"学号"。"实体集"是一组具有相同特性的实体,如所有学生组成的学生实体集。"实体型"则是定义实体及其属性的组合,如"学生"实体型可能包括"学号"、"姓名"、"性别"、"年龄"等属性。 在信息世界中,"概念模型"是对现实世界进行抽象,用于描述实体、属性和实体间的关系。"数据模型"是概念模型在计算机世界中的实现,是计算机能够理解和处理的形式。在本例中,"教学院系数据库"就是数据模型的一个实例,它包含了院系、教研室、学生和教师的数据结构及其关系。 通过SQLServer2000这样的数据库管理系统,可以将这些概念模型转化为实际的数据模型,以便存储和处理数据。数据库的建立过程通常包括定义实体、属性、联系,然后创建数据表,最后通过SQL语句进行数据操作。在这个过程中,"记录"对应于现实世界的实体实例,"数据项"代表实体的特征,而"数据间的联系"则反映了实体间的关联。 总结来说,教学院系数据模型展示了如何构建和理解信息在现实世界、信息世界和计算机世界之间的转换,以及如何在数据库系统中实现这一转换,为教育管理提供有效支持。